v2.3.1 Release Notes (3/20/2023)

v2.3.1 Release Notes: - Improve performance by not showing NPC characters too far from the player - Improve performance by not showing lit torches that are too far from the player - Improve performance by not showing shimmers around levers and ancient relics too far from the player - Put an eye gizmo above NPCs the player needs to use sneak to avoid - Changed false walls to look different from normal walls (using cloth physics) - Improved wolf behavior and attacking - Improved character responsiveness by increasing jump recovery animation speed - Fixed issues getting stuck in the lift animation for barrels and doors - Base Camp: If the player pushes the button for the current level don't reload it - Mission 1: Prompt the player to light torches if they have not lit the first few - Mission 2: Removed physics-based jugs that caused lag if the player ran through them - Mission 5: Redesign the pressure plate puzzle to be more realistic - Mission 7: Fixed Gahiji's minions slanting after they turned the corner. - Mission 7: Added targets to place the barrels to slow Gahiji down - Mission 8: Updated the locusts to move more realistically - Mission 9: Added a note to the player for levers that open doors to rooms they aren't in - Mission 9: Fixed the torch that wouldn't light - Mission 9: Moved pots in the rotating statue puzzle room that caused the player to fall through the floor - Mission 9: Fixed issue where upon completing this mission, mission 10 would not unlock - Mission 10: If the pillar doesn't fall exactly on the chariot, still count it as destroying it
